Characters for The Kawai Complex Guide to Manors and Hostel Behavior

Kawai Complex

Kazunari Usa

Voiced by Yūichi Iguchi
  • All-Loving Hero: The Snark Knight he may be, but Usa is friendly to everyone, even those who he has no reason to. Though that won't stop him from calling them out on their behavior.
  • Butt-Monkey: Tends to be a frequent victim of Mayumi's pranks, and Ritsu's wooden sword, as well as her Brutal Honesty.
  • Cannot Spit It Out: Manages to be both this and a Dogged Nice Guy. Justified example too, as it's made clear that even if Ritsu is in love with him, she'll likely reject him simply out of her anti-social behavior. It's only after she defrosts that there's any chance she might say yes.
  • Character Development: At the start, Usa is the Only Sane Man who's totally bewildered by the rest of the residents and even those outside of it. Over time, he becomes more and more unfazed by the situations he faces whereas outsiders act bewildered. Additionally, his interactions with Ritsu become more natural and genuine as he continues to reach out to her, eventually learning to share each other's interests wholeheartedly. See Dogged Nice Guy for more details on that.
  • Clueless Chick-Magnet: Has three girls his own age into him, and even Mayumi is implied to be searching for a man similar to Usa, though not Usa himself due to the obvious age difference.
  • Deadpan Snarker: Being around so many zany people tend sharpen a person's tongue.
  • Dogged Nice Guy: A Decon-Recon Switch of the idealistic variant and a justified example. Ritsu doesn't take kindly to any overt romantic (or sexual) gestures or interaction due to her anti-social nature. It's directly stated that due to Usa's patience and kindness that she's able to trust him enough to get closer and closer, eventually falling in love with him. As Ritsu had other admirers who tried but didn't have the patience. The Deconsturction comes in when he ends up pestering her too much to her annoyance thanks to Sayaka's manipulation. Causing Ritsu to lash out at his behavior and get fed up with him. The Reconstruction occurs when he ends up realizing the error of his ways, leading to him learning to give Ritsu her space and not be clingy. Allowing her to not be the center of his world, nor him be the center of her world. His patience, kindness, and understanding nature allows him to win Ritsu's heart in the end.
  • Extreme Doormat: At least initially. Best seen while at work while the customers mistreat him. However, this seems to only apply to himself, in that he'll stand up for others without hesitation like Hayashi and Ritsu, but not for himself. Though to be fair, he does stand up for himself most other times, but Usa being Usa, he usually doesn't succeed. He gradually outgrows this though.
  • Nice Guy: He's too nice for his own good. This is how his eccentric classmates flocked to him in the past.
  • Only Sane Man: He's the only normal person in a building full of eccentric people, and has had to deal with eccentric classmates with unique quirks back in middle school. This trait actually lands him a job set up by a Sumiko and her friend.
  • The Snark Knight: He reaches this status due to many of his barbs being aimed at himself almost as frequently as every other character. Despite that, Usa is without a doubt a Nice Guy with high standards of decency.
  • Unfazed Everyman: Slowly becomes more and more at ease and comfortable with the rest of the residents and their antics.
  • Weirdness Magnet: It's the reason why he was called Freak Show at school in the past. His Nice Guy status is the likely explanation as for why so many quirky people end up being drawn to him.

Ritsu Kawai

Voiced by Kana Hanazawa
  • Brutally Honest: She has a habit of being too straight with people, and it can lead to hurting another person's feelings.
  • Dandere: She's quiet and standoffish to pretty much everyone. Thanks to Usa's efforts, she mellows out.
  • Character Development: Goes from an anti-social bookworm to someone who's more open emotionally and branches out her interests such as playing videogames with Usa. By the end, she has a much wider circle of friends than she did at the start.
  • Endearingly Dorky: Lamp-shaded by Usa. She can be a really big dork, and it's adorable.
  • Deadpan Snarker: She apparently got from Sumiko, to Shiro's delight.
  • Defrosting Ice Queen: Initially very distant and aloof to everyone. Then she becomes more open and warm, making many friends along the way thanks to Usa's influence.
  • I Just Want to Have Friends: Defied. She says she's okay with being alone, but that doesn't mean she wants to completely alone, and does want some companionship.
  • No Social Skills: Outright stated by Usa to be anti-social. Episode 3 shows her trying to apologize for bluntly rejecting Usa's offer for a bike ride, but after a while she starts rambling, eventually leading her to clearly wondering why her words aren't coming the way she wants them to.
  • Only Sane Man: Subverted. She turns out to be Not So Above It All. Next to Usa, she initially seemed to be the only normal person in a building full of eccentric people. Only for her anti-social behavior and fixation on books to make her come across as just as weird as everyone else, just less so.
  • Shrinking Violet: She comes across as cold, but she's actually shy.
  • Sugar-and-Ice Personality: Initially, she's often aloof and seems disinterested, except when something regarding books is mentioned or laughs at Usa's jokes.
  • When She Smiles: A smile certainly suits her better than the usual blank expression.

Sumiko

Voiced by Sanae Kobayashi
  • Cool Old Lady: The definition of it. She even makes favorite foods for anyone who feels depressed.
  • Tranquil Fury: She uses this to keep Mayumi and Sayaka in line when they get too rambunctious or mischievous.

Shirosaki Shizuru

Voiced by Go Shinomiya
  • Butt-Monkey: Shares this with Usa, but Shiro enjoys it thanks to his masochism.
  • Chivalrous Pervert: He's a perverted masochist, but is still a nice guy. He's also quick to voice his dislike of molesters, and treats Chinatsu's Precocious Crush on him like a phase she's going through.
  • Cool Old Guy: Probably the second oldest person living in the Kawai complex, and despite his perversion, he does share a few words of wisdom to the other tenants.
  • Hidden Depths: Dude's a writer. Specifically he's secretly Ritsu's favorite author, not that she's aware.

Mayumi Nishikino

Voiced by Rina Sato
  • Fool for Love: She'll often say Silly Rabbit, Romance Is for Kids! and try to crush their dreams. But the moment an ex or admirer of hers shows any interest, she drops everything and willfully ignores reason and logic.
  • Has a Type: Asides from the All Girls Want Bad Boys aspect, Shirosaki suggests that her outburst over Usa seemingly giving up on Ritsu implies that her ideal man is one who's persistent and kind to the woman he loves. Essentially someone like Usa, though not Usa himself.
  • Jerk with a Heart of Gold: She's fond of teasing Usa over his crush on Ritsu, but she still acts as sort of Cool Big Sis to him when the situation calls for it.
  • Looking for Love in All the Wrong Places: Lampshaded consistently by everyone else. Her All Girls Want Bad Boys behavior is a byproduct of this, as all the men have cheated on her, with the number of people being higher than the previous one.
  • Ms. Fanservice: The only attractive thing about her is figure. Can't say the same thing for her personality.
  • Shameless Fanservice Girl: A Deconstructive Parody of the archetype, as Usa is at first attracted to her physically, even despite her wretched personality. Few episodes in, and because she's always showing a lot of skin, Usa is literally unfazed and has gotten used to her appearance. Not helped by her childish behavior being a complete turnoff.
  • Ship Tease: With Shirosaki later in the manga.
  • Unkempt Beauty: In contrast to Sayaka, Mayumi is rarely well-dress and groomed. Often showing lots of skin wearing as well.
  • Womanchild: All the adults are this to a degree, but Mayumi is the most childish, even compared to Chinatsu, who is in elementary school.

Sayaka Watanabe

Voiced by Hisako Kanemoto
  • Absurd Phobia: She's scared of cute and cuddly rabbits.
  • Bitch in Sheep's Clothing: Acts sweet and innocent, but her hobby is seducing men and then bumping them after a while.
  • Hidden Heart of Gold: She cares about her childhood friend, but tries very hard not to show it.
  • The Fake Cutie: Initially set up to be The Cutie to Mayumi's seductress, but is shown to have just as abhorrent a personality as Mayumi, and perhaps even more so.
  • Troll: She's not even The Gadfly as what she says usually goes beyond bizarre and causing bewilderment. Instead she really loves getting a rise out of Mayumi, either by bringing up her relationship issues, or groping her. It's not the riling up of others that she enjoys, it's the suffering.
